Key Limes: A Zesty Citrus Delight

Published

on

Key limes, scientifically known as Citrus aurantiifolia, are a small, aromatic citrus fruit celebrated for their distinctive tart and tangy flavor. Originating from Southeast Asia, these limes made their way to the Florida Keys, where they gained prominence and became a staple ingredient in various culinary delights, most notably the iconic Key lime pie.

Characteristics and Cultivation

Key limes are smaller and rounder than the more common Persian limes, with a diameter of about 1-2 inches. Their thin, smooth skin turns from green to yellow as they ripen, and they contain numerous seeds. The fruit’s juice is more acidic and aromatic than that of Persian limes, imparting a unique, zesty flavor to dishes and beverages.

These limes thrive in warm, subtropical climates and are primarily grown in the Florida Keys, Mexico, and the Caribbean. The trees are relatively small, bushy, and thorny, requiring well-drained soil and plenty of sunlight. Due to their sensitivity to cold, Key lime trees are often grown in containers in cooler regions, allowing for easy relocation during colder months.

Culinary Uses
Key limes

The most famous use of Key lime is in Key lime pie, a dessert that showcases the fruit’s tartness balanced with sweetness. This pie typically consists of a graham cracker crust, a creamy filling made from Key lime juice, sweetened condensed milk, and egg yolks, topped with whipped cream or meringue.

Key lime juice is also a popular ingredient in marinades, salad dressings, and cocktails, such as the classic Key lime margarita. Its vibrant acidity enhances seafood dishes, ceviche, and salsas, adding a refreshing twist to a variety of recipes.

Nutritional Benefits

Key lime is a rich source of vitamin C, an essential nutrient that supports immune function, skin health, and antioxidant protection. They also contain small amounts of vitamins A and B, calcium, and potassium. The fruit’s high acidity can aid digestion and provide a natural preservative effect in culinary applications.

DIY Potpourri: A Natural Way to Scent Your Home

Published

on

By

Potpourri is a charming and natural way to freshen your space while adding a decorative touch. Made from dried flowers, herbs, spices, and essential oils, potpourri is easy to customize and perfect for gifting or personal use. Here’s how to make your own at home.

What Is Potpourri?

Potpourri is a mixture of dried botanicals infused with fragrance. It serves as a natural air freshener that can be displayed in bowls, jars, or sachets. Unlike synthetic air fresheners, potpourri offers a chemical-free and visually appealing option.

Ingredients for DIY Potpourri

1. Dried Flowers and Herbs: Common choices include roses, lavender, chamomile, or marigolds.
potpourri

2. Spices: Add cloves, cinnamon sticks, or star anise for warmth and depth.

3. Citrus Peels: Dried orange or lemon peels provide a fresh, zesty aroma.

4. Essential Oils: Enhance the scent with a few drops of your favorite oil, such as lavender, eucalyptus, or vanilla.

5. Fixatives: Use orris root powder or ground cinnamon to help retain the fragrance longer.
potpourri

How to Make Potpourri

1. Prepare Your Ingredients: Dry your flowers, herbs, and citrus peels completely to prevent mold. Use a dehydrator, oven, or air-dry method.

2. Mix Your Base: Combine the dried ingredients in a large bowl.

3. Add Essential Oils: Sprinkle 10–15 drops of essential oil onto the mixture and stir well.

4. Include a Fixative: Add a small amount of orris root or cinnamon powder to lock in the scent.

5. Store for Scenting: Place the mixture in an airtight container and let it sit for 1–2 weeks to allow the fragrances to meld. Shake the container occasionally to distribute the scent.

6. Display Your Potpourri: Transfer the mixture to bowls, jars, or sachets for use around your home.

Tips for Customization

– Experiment with different flower and herb combinations to create unique scents.

– Refresh the aroma with a few drops of essential oil when needed.

Treatment for glaucoma. Many conditions involving elevated eye pressure that result in irreversible vision loss and blindness are referred to as glaucoma. The majority of the causes of this condition are treatable. You may be able to prevent vision loss by being aware of the risk factors and scheduling routine eye exams. It is impossible to undo the harm that glaucoma has caused. However, if the disease is detected early, treatment and routine examinations can help slow or prevent vision loss.

TREATMENT FOR GLAUCOMA

Reducing intraocular pressure is the goal of glaucoma treatment. Prescription eye drops, oral medications, laser therapy, surgery, or a mix of these are available as forms of treatment. In addition to doing a thorough eye exam, an eye care specialist will go over your medical history. A number of tests could be conducted.

Treatment

1. Eye drops Prescription

Eye drops are frequently the first step in the treatment of glaucoma. Some may reduce Eye pain by enhancing the eye’s ability to drain fluid. Others cause the eye to produce less fluid. Several eye drops might be recommended, depending on how low the eye pressure needs to be. Oral medications Eye drops might not be enough to lower eye pressure to the appropriate level.

2. Oral

Therefore, an ophthalmologist may also recommend oral medication. Usually, this medication inhibits carbonic anhydrase. Frequent urination, tingling in the fingers and toes, depression, upset stomach, and kidney stones are some of the possible side effects.
